Electrical impedance tomography (EIT) is a bedside imaging technique in which voltage data arising from current applied on electrodes is used to compute images of admittivity in real time. Due to the severe ill-posedness of the inverse problem, good spatial resolution poses a challenge in EIT. Conversely, the temporal resolution is high, facilitating dynamic bedside imaging.

Abortion bans and restrictions may have ripple effects on other forms of sexual and reproductive health care such as contraception provision. While only a small proportion of publicly supported sexual and reproductive health clinics offer abortion care, many are likely experiencing direct and indirect impacts of the June 2022 Supreme Court decision. We analyzed data from a national survey of 446 clinics conducted between November 2022 and December 2023 to understand provision of pregnancy options counseling, miscarriage management, and abortion, as well as perceived changes in patient demand for contraception, abortion referrals, and pregnancy options counseling.

The multi-center, international consortium on endometrial cancer held in January 2025 at Mayo Clinic in Rochester, Minnesota brought together leading experts in gynecologic oncology to explore the latest advancements in the understanding, diagnosis, and treatment of endometrial cancer. Discussions centered on key topics, including updates in molecular testing and disease staging, emerging treatment strategies for advanced and recurrent disease, fertility-sparing management, and critical pathology challenges, particularly, the assessment of lympho-vascular space invasion. Each topic was examined in dedicated working group sessions, fostering in-depth exchanges to identify research priorities and develop actionable strategies.

The purpose of this work is to evaluate the feasibility of lung imaging using 3D electrical impedance tomography (EIT) during spontaneous breathing trials (SBTs) in patients with acute hypoxic respiratory failure. EIT is a noninvasive, nonionizing, real-time functional imaging technique, suitable for bedside monitoring in critically ill patients. EIT data were collected in 24 mechanically ventilated patients immediately preceding and during a SBT on two rows of 16 electrodes using a simultaneous multicurrent source EIT system for 3D imaging.
View Article and Find Full Text PDFFertility-sparing treatment (FST) has become a key aspect of managing gynecologic cancers in reproductive-age patients who wish to preserve fertility. Several leading clinical societies, including the European Society of Gynecological Oncology, the European Society for Radiotherapy and Oncology, the European Society of Pathology, and the European Society of Human Reproduction and Embryology, have published evidence-based guidelines on fertility-sparing strategies and post-treatment surveillance of patients with early-stage gynecologic cancers, in particular endometrial and cervical cancers. These guidelines highlight MRI as essential to initial patient selection and follow-up.
